    What is Aygestin 5 mg?

    Aygestin 5 mg is a medication that contains the active ingredient norethindrone, a synthetic progesterone. It is used to treat conditions such as heavy menstrual bleeding, endometriosis, and abnormal uterine bleeding. Aygestin 5 mg works by regulating the menstrual cycle and reducing the growth of the uterine lining, which can help to reduce symptoms such as heavy bleeding and cramping.

    Types of Menstrual Problems and Uterine Issues

    There are several types of menstrual problems and uterine issues that women may experience. Some of the most common include:

    1. Abnormal Bleeding: This is one of the most common menstrual problems, characterized by heavy, prolonged, or irregular bleeding. Abnormal bleeding can be caused by a variety of factors, including hormonal imbalances, uterine fibroids, and certain medical conditions.
    2. Endometriosis: This is a condition in which tissue similar to the lining of the uterus grows outside of the uterus, leading to pain, inflammation, and scarring. Endometriosis can cause heavy bleeding, pelvic pain, and infertility.
    3. Uterine Fibroids: These are non-cancerous growths that develop in the uterus, often causing heavy bleeding, pelvic pain, and pressure on the bladder or bowel.
    4. Polycystic Ovary Syndrome (PCOS): This is a hormonal disorder that affects ovulation, often leading to irregular periods, cysts on the ovaries, and infertility.
    5. Pelvic Inflammatory Disease (PID): This is an infection of the female reproductive organs, often caused by sexually transmitted bacteria. PID can lead to pelvic pain, infertility, and increased risk of ectopic pregnancy.

    Treatment Options for Menstrual Problems and Uterine Issues

    Treatment options for menstrual problems and uterine issues depend on the specific condition and severity of symptoms. Some common treatment options include:

    Condition Treatment Options
    Abnormal Bleeding Hormonal birth control, tranexamic acid, or surgical procedures such as endometrial ablation
    Endometriosis Hormonal birth control, pain relief medication, or surgical procedures such as laparoscopy or hysterectomy
    Uterine Fibroids Hormonal birth control, pain relief medication, or surgical procedures such as myomectomy or hysterectomy
    PCOS Hormonal birth control, fertility medication, or lifestyle changes such as weight loss and exercise
    PID Antibiotics or surgical procedures such as laparoscopy or hysterectomy
